OK so I'm green with envy. When I built my house 25 years ago I went
with propane. Propane and electricity are a toss up now depending on
what price you can get your propane for. I still do hot water with
propane. There just ain't no free lunch....but I keep looking. ;-)

> > Wanted a closed loop water to air but the permitting process is insane. 
> > Even more insane is the open loop type that wastes water requires no 
> > special permit. So went with a 16 SEER Trane air to air. It'll work down to 
> > 20 degrees F.
